Sumario:The properties of a new possible class of events, characterised by large hadronic densities and very few clans, in proton-proton collisions at LHC energy are explored within the mechanism of the weighted superposition of different substructures. The most surprising feature is the appearance of an "elbow structure" in the high multiplicity tail, leading to very large expected multiplicity fluctuations.
